Julie, I clean my candle jars putting them in the microwave for like 40 seconds, the jars are empty, no wax , you can add more seconds if needed , make sure the labels don't have metal/gold like some of the bath and body works candles have. If they do, I just remove the label. Then, grab the jar with something to protect your hands, I just use a paper towel, and then clean the inside of the jars with paper towels. They clean out very good like this! and after I wash them in the sink with Hot soapy water. They look pretty nice and clean this way. And the most important part it takes only few minutes! I agree with Claudia @claudiadelpapa1243 about warming them in the microwave. Just remember to wipe them out with the paper towel or an old rag while the wax is still hot so that it will wipe off of the inside of the glass smoothly. I am positive this will be the answer to your problem to getting all of the wax residue off of the insides of the glass jars.
